Its stems and leaves are covered in dense hair, which provides the soft to the touch feeling that both adults and children enjoy. It matures to an average height of 1 inch to 1 foot and an average width of 1 foot to 2 feet, depending on climate and other environmental factors. It can be propagated by division.Woolly Thyme is a moderate growing groundcover plant, herb and perennial plant that can be grown in USDA Plant Hardiness Zones 5A through 8B. This species is not originally from North America. Consider covering it with a thick layer of mulch in winter to protect it in exposed locations or colder microclimates. It is highly tolerant of urban pollution and will even thrive in inner city environments. It is not particular as to soil type or pH. It is considered to be drought-tolerant, and thus makes an ideal choice for a low-water garden or xeriscape application. It prefers to grow in average to dry locations, and dislikes excessive moisture. This plant should only be grown in full sunlight. Ideal for rockeries, herb gardens and containers. In spring this spreading perennial plant produces small, tubular pink or white flowers (depending on variety). It grows at a fast rate, and under ideal conditions can be expected to live for approximately 10 years. Its foliage tends to remain low and dense right to the ground.
